Mother Earth cries out in pain:
O Man! Let me be, the way I am!
Let my natural habitat remain as it is.
Do not stamp over my soil,
Do not tamper with my identity,
Do not cut the trees and wipe out the greens!
O Man! You are greedy and selfish,
You disregard and disrespect me!
I have given you a beautiful land to live
Yet, you are out to kill and destroy,
The very environment that has sheltered you!
Remember! You were born and will die too, on this earth!
While you live your life on planet earth,
Let the flowers bloom and spread its fragrance,
Let the trees breathe to give you enough oxygen,
Let the rivers flow, the wind blow, the earth glow!
Live happily, peacefully in harmony with nature's environment,
Live a beautiful and loving life, bonding with Mother Earth.
Happy World Environment Day! Save the soil & earth!
